
Can I use real candles in the Reception Hall at Bayou Haven?
Yes! Bayou Haven is proud to be one of the few wedding venues in Central Louisiana that allows the use of real candles.
To ensure safety, candles must be stationary and placed on stable surfaces such as tables. They must also be enclosed in nonflammable containers, like glass vases. Please do not place any decorations or materials inside the container with the flame—only water is permitted. All decorative elements should remain outside the candle holder.
For areas with higher foot traffic, we recommend using battery-operated tea lights as a safer alternative.

Can we have fireworks on the property?
For safety reasons, fireworks are not permitted on the property—indoors or outdoors—unless you receive specific, prior approval fro the Fire Marshal and venue owners.

Can we use wedding sparklers for our exit?
Yes, wedding sparklers are allowed for outdoor use, as long as they meet our safety guidelines. Please be aware that you can only use sparklers at the front exit. Sparklers are not allowed in the back by the artificial turf. The sparks and hot wires melt and damage the tuft.
If you plan to use sparklers, it’s important that you purchase ones specifically designed for weddings. Standard sparklers from fireworks stands are not allowed—they burn much hotter, produce excessive smoke, and pose a higher risk of injury. They also make it difficult to capture clear, beautiful photos.

Can I hang greenery on the Chapel Wall or on the Pews??
Yes! It is very common for couples to want to have greenery on the Chapel wall behind them for their ceremony, or even flowers on the pews. Although we allow this, we do not allow any nails, tape or command strips.
Wall: For greenery on the chapel wall, please use the pre-existing hooks that are in the wall. Use floral string or wire to attach your florals to these hooks that are already in the wall.
Pews: You can carefully hang florals on the ends of the Pew Caps, but you MUST use either ribbon or cotton string to loop over the pew. DO NOT use wire or any attachments that would scratch or damage the pew or the paint.
